A suspect has been arrested for duct-taping and abandoning a cat in the backyard of a home in the 2200 block of Edgley Street in North Philadelphia earlier this month.
The arrest was made by an enforcement officer for the Pennsylvania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als. The cat was found Sept. 22.
The PSPCA offered a reward of $2,000 for the conviction of whoever did the deed to the female cat, nicknamed "Sticky" by workers at the society. Only the cat's head was uncovered; she had to be sedated while the tape was cut off.
